Isolate three dominant neutral colors (e.g., black, cream, navy) and two accent colors (e.g., olive green, burnt orange) from your gallery. Restricting your wardrobe to this specific palette ensures that almost every item you own will automatically complement the others. Step 3: Fill the Gaps INDIAN.ACTRESSES.NUDE.PHOTOS.-BY.KAMAPISACHI

Monochromatic outfits (all black or all cream) can look flat without texture. Break up the visual monotony by mixing contrasting materials in a single look: Pair rough with soft silk . Combine chunky knitwear with sleek leather . Juxtapose crisp poplin cotton with heavy suede . Rule 3: The Three-Color Rule

Historically, style galleries were confined to the glossy pages of high-fashion magazines. Editorial teams curated these lookbooks months in advance. Today, digital galleries offer real-time updates. Social media platforms, digital portfolios, and interactive fashion blogs have democratized style inspiration. Anyone with a camera and a unique perspective can contribute to the global style dialogue. The Rise of Street Style Documentation
